## Runbook: Carving the user module out of Hearthstack

Quick reminder for the sync: we're strangling, not big-banging. Reads go through the new Userling service behind a feature flag; writes still dual-path to the monolith until drift checks pass for a week. If drift exceeds ten rows a day, flip the flag off and ping on-call. Current canary is running the build tagged below.

trace token, fafog-kageg: htk4_98e6

## Runbook: Gaugepile Sidecar — Release Checklist

Heads up: the sidecar ships with every app pod, so a bad config fans out fast. Before cutting a release, confirm the flush interval hasn't drifted from what the Tallyhouse aggregator expects, or you'll see sawtooth gaps in dashboards. Rollbacks are cheap — just repin the image tag. Canary one node pool first, watch for ten minutes, then proceed. The values to verify against are these.

config for bagep-yafof:
quenath:
  pin: 8584
  metrics_host: metrics.quenath.tolvaqsys.internal
  tenant: pelath
  seal: seal_ed102645

## Deploying the Gatewick Proctor Queue

Deploys are pretty painless: push to main, wait for the pipeline, then watch the queue drain dashboard for five minutes. If candidates pile up mid-exam, roll back first and ask questions later — the queue replays safely. Everything the workers care about lives in one config block, shown here for reference.

settings of bafof-yagef:
JOROX_PIN=8740
JOROX_TENANT=pelox
JOROX_METRICS_HOST=metrics.jorox.qorvelworks.internal
JOROX_SEAL=seal_c78f63c1
JOROX_STANDBY_TEAM=norax

Subject: Handover — tailstream CLI and release signing

Hi Marisol,

Before I roll off, a few notes on tailstream, our internal CLI for log tailing. Support should use `tailstream follow --env staging` for live triage; the `--since` flag accepts relative durations. Releases are cut weekly from the Fernvale pipeline, and the binary won't install unless the package signature validates. I rotated credentials yesterday per policy, so discard anything cached locally. The current deploy key is as follows.

deploy key for kajof-fajop: bky6_gDHw9Q